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Moorfields to Bleasby start from as little as £14.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Moorfields to Bleasby are available for £67.90 one way, or £95.40 return

Moorfields Station Facilities

The station boasts a range of fac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office maintains long operating hours, opening from early morning until after midnight on Mondays and Sundays, complemented by easily accessible ticket machines for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. For passengers with smartphones, smartcard services are available, simplifying your journey. Assistance for those requiring support is provided through help points and an information-friendly ticket office. Despite its numerous amenities, the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, though a seating area is available.

Accessibility is a priority at Moorfields, with step-free access to all platforms courtesy of lifts, although note, the Old Hall Street entrance does not accommodate disabled access. Additional services include accessible toilets and support for those with visual and hearing impairments, with an induction loop and visual announcements across the station.

Transportation Links and Onward Travel

Connecting from Moorfields to your final destination is seamless thanks to various transport links. Unfortunately, there isn't a taxi rank directly at the station, but local buses serve as convenient alternatives to reach broader Liverpool areas. For those heading to Liverpool John Lennon Airport, integrated rail and bus tickets are available, offering a hassle-free connection via Liverpool South Parkway station using routes 86A or 80A.

Station Facilities at a Glance

Bleasby station is designed for simplicity and practicality. It’s a small, unstaffed station, so purchasing tickets online beforehand is advisable as there are no ticket machines or offices for collection. However, you’ll find an induction loop available, ensuring clarity in communication for those with hearing aids.

Accessibility is partially available and the station entrance involves ramps with varied gradients: a moderate one for Platform 1 and a steeper option for Platform 2. The crossing between platforms employs an uneven surface, so plan accordingly if accessibility is a concern.

Considering its size, you won't find amenities like waiting rooms, seating, toilets, refreshment facilities, or bicycle storage here. Yet, for simple travel, Bleasby does offer essential services - like CCTV security and a customer help point - to make your journey safe and straightforward.

Connecting Beyond the Train

For those looking to explore or commute beyond Bleasby, several transport solutions are available. Rail replacement services operate via the road adjacent to the level crossing, and you can make use of local taxi services such as Westons, contactable at 01636 815474. Although the station itself lacks extensive bus services, you can plan your onward journey using provided resources available here.
